Коммутаторы позволяют настроить работу протокола SNMP для удаленного мониторинга и управления устройством. Устройство поддерживает протоколы версий SNMPv1, SNMPv2, SNMPv3.
Ниже приведен пример настройки SNMPv3 юзера без аутентификации и без шифрования, юзера только с аутентификацией и юзера с шифрованием и аутентификацией:
console(config)#
snmp user UserNoAuthNoPriv
console(config)#
snmp user UserAuthNoPriv auth md5 PasswordAuthMD5
console(config)#
snmp user UserAuthPriv auth sha PasswordAuthSHA priv DES PasswordPrivDES
console(config)#
snmp group GroupNoAuthNoPriv user UserNoAuthNoPriv security-model v3
console(config)#
snmp group GroupAuthNoPriv user UserAuthNoPriv security-model v3
console(config)#
snmp group GroupAuthPriv user UserAuthPriv security-model v3
console(config)#
snmp access GroupNoAuthNoPriv v3 noauth read iso write iso notify iso
console(config)#
snmp access GroupAuthNoPriv v3 auth read iso write iso notify iso
console(config)#
snmp access GroupAuthPriv v3 priv read iso write iso notify iso
console(config)#
snmp view iso 1 included
Пример команды SNMPv3 из консоли Linux OS:
snmpwalk -v3 -u "username" -a SHA -A "auth_password" -x DES -X "priv_password" -l authPriv 192.168.1.141 iso.3.6.1.2.1.1.5.0